Open Forum <br /> No one appeared for open forum. <br /> 6.1 District 30A House Representative Nick Zerwas Legislative Update <br /> Mr. Zerwas provided an update on legislative activities. <br /> 6.2 Elk River Girls Fastpitch Softball Registration <br /> The Council acknowledged the Elk River girls fastpitch softball team on their state <br /> championship. <br /> Stacey Sheetz,head coach,thanked the Mayor for inviting the team to attend the meeting <br /> and expressed her appreciation for the Mayor and Council's acknowledgement of their <br /> season. <br /> 6.3 Volunteer of the Month <br /> Mayor Dietz introduced,read,and presented a plaque to the June Volunteer of the Month <br /> James Holt. He highlighted some of Mr.Holt's volunteer accomplishments: <br /> • Beyond the Yellow Ribbon Steering Committee and Faith-Based Committee. <br /> • Board member of Great River Family Promise's emergency homeless shelter <br /> program for children and their families. <br /> • Love Elk River board member. <br /> • Elk River Community Fireworks Committee. <br /> • Money life mentor for Crown Financial Ministries <br /> • Social Justice Committee at the Church of Saint Andrew. <br /> Mr. Holt stated he is very honored to receive the award and encouraged citizens to <br /> volunteer. <br /> 7.1 Tim Pomerleau (Khever Lake Fields 4th <br /> A.
